Abstract

Single Crystals of the superconductor YBa 2Cu 3O 7-∂ have been grown with controlled amounts of aluminium doping just below the twin to tweed transition (1 and 1.5 cationic%) and are examined using single crystal x-ray diffraction and TEM. The nature of the twinning changes from well defined twins and colonies in undoped crystals to an interpenetrating twin morphology as the tweed transition is approached.
